Dear all,
I have done a Fine-Grained Audit on table tb_log, then i select the table and delete the table,but the FGA_LOG$ do not store the sqltext,how can i know which is the select statement or delete statement?

BEGIN
  DBMS_FGA.ADD_POLICY(
   object_schema      => 'SCOTT',
   object_name        => 'TB_LOG',
   policy_name        => 'CHK_HR_TB_LOG',
   enable             =>  TRUE,
   statement_types    => 'INSERT, UPDATE, SELECT, DELETE',
   audit_trail        =>  DBMS_FGA.DB);
END;


select count(1) from tb_log;
delete from tb_log;


SQL> select  sessionid, oshst, sqltext from FGA_LOG$;

 SESSIONID OSHST                SQLTEXT
---------- -------------------- --------------------
       228 WORKGROUP\HXL
       228 WORKGROUP\HXL
